Özet

Teacher training programs require observation of actual school environment by student teachers before they actually start teaching under the supervision of an experienced teacher. Student teachers observe host teachers and students; they gain insights into classroom management and become acquainted with school organization and administration. This study is conducted with 25 student teachers in English Language Teaching department at a large state university in Turkey. Student teachers have corresponded with their instructor for 12 weeks after each school observation. This paper will consider the contents of the dialogue journals via the e-mail between the teacher trainees and their trainer during their School Experience with particular emphasis on insights into their observations and the feasibility of the process. By way of summary, this paper will also highlight the strengths and weaknesses of the process and suggest ways of incorporating the dialogue journal in language teacher education.
